Entrepreneurial Investments: Voucher Program
$100,000.00
Grant
Description:
The Voucher Program provides Alberta tech and innovation companies with up to $100,000 to accelerate new product toward commercialization for novel, promising technologies, and an identified product/market fit.
Comments on Funding:
The Voucher Program provides support within the range from $10,001 to $100,000. The applicant is required to contribute a minimum 25% cash contribution to the total eligible project costs.

Eligibility:
Applicants must:
1. Exist as a corporate person, with up-to-date corporate filings.
2. Be authorized to undertake the proposed project, and execute a grant with Alberta Innovates on our standard terms; and
3. Not otherwise be prohibited from receiving Alberta Innovates funding, for instance due to a past bad debt or otherwise not be in good financial standing with Alberta Innovates or its subsidiaries, InnoTech Alberta and C-FER Technologies.
4. Be incorporated in Alberta and/or incorporated for-profit organizations in another jurisdiction and extra-provincially registered in Alberta, OR
5. Be a for-profit organization General Partnership, Limited Partnership or Limited Liability Partnership and registered in Alberta.
6. Be a company that have fewer than 500 full-time employees and less than $50,000,000 in annual gross revenue to qualify as a small or medium enterprise (SME).
7. Be a company and must be Alberta-based with an Alberta footprint, which includes a significant physical and corporate operational presence in Alberta; appropriate Alberta ownership; and discernible intent that operational benefits will flow primarily within the Province of Alberta.
Application Steps:
Applicants must:
1. Engage with a Technology Development Advisor (TDA) prior to applying online.
2. Access and submit application form SmartSimple Online Application Portal. Applications outline must provide:
–Current state of the opportunity,
–Applicant’s business readiness
–Participation of a service provider
–Intended project and benefits
–Applicant’s current financial state

Service Provider Eligibility
Service Providers are required to:
1. Be a registered corporate entity, or a sole proprietorship, and where applicable be in good standing with the appropriate corporate registries.
2. Be authorized to undertake the proposed project.
3. Demonstrate that the relationship between the Applicant and Partner/Strategic Partner/Service Provider/Collaborator does not create a conflict of interest.
4. Be at arm’s length from the Applicant (i.e., no legal relationship with the Applicant).
5. Provide the service(s) and/or product(s) at reasonable market rates.
6. Provide a letter indicating the Partner’s/Service Provider’s/Collaborator’s intention to participate in the Project at the time of application.
7. Show tangible resources committed to the Project.
8. Not otherwise be prohibited from receiving Alberta Innovates funding, for instance due to a past bad debt or otherwise not be in good financial standing with Alberta Innovates or its subsidiaries, InnoTech Alberta and C-FER Technologies.
